I don't know about that. I thought about minting my own physical coins and the prices from mints were pretty far above "spot". To get a price anywhere close to "spot" required a purchase of a really enormous amount of precious metal up front and a commitment to a large number of coins. At that point the business plan of a physical litecoin/bitcoin company becomes more precious metal speculation and less minting coins, because the value of your stock can fluctuate so dramatically while you're waiting to sell them.
